Output 43c106ae86c6637cb39a424285443a5e7cfb6a6b302a4d4836a9d500e74e95d3:1

value
39824350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dc81e7f66388bbacd294db343305545bd790e2 OP_EQUAL
address
3PC8skSg8XGmyvGN71GVTgRCkHL7DoiqDs
transaction
43c106ae86c6637cb39a424285443a5e7cfb6a6b302a4d4836a9d500e74e95d3
spent
true